About You / What We Are Looking For


The City of Coquitlam is seeking a dynamic and strategic leader with a strong background in strategic planning, business transformation and budget management to join our team as Manager, Business and Innovation. This is a unique opportunity for a forward-thinking professional to help shape the future of our city by modernizing services, enhancing operational excellence, and driving innovation within the Planning and Development Department.


Reporting directly to the General Manager of Planning and Development, this role will lead transformative initiatives that improve how we deliver services to the community. The successful candidate will act as a key connector between the department and the broader organization - championing strategic projects, advancing policy development, and aligning departmental operations with the City's long-term vision.


The Manager, Business and Innovation currently oversees two dedicated teams: the Business Services team and the Administrative Services team, with a total of 10 direct reports.


Other key responsibilities include:


Lead strategic initiatives, business planning, and performance reporting, including annual and trimester updates. Manage operating and capital budgets, monitor expenditures, and approve procurement-related documentation. Provide policy, budget, and strategic advice to Council, Committees, and senior leadership. Lead the Development Application Process Review initiative to ensure the development process is as efficient and effective as possible through operational efficiencies, digital process transformation, use of automation, and enhanced customer service, Champion interdepartmental collaboration, innovation, diversity, and continuous improvement. Ensure program and service delivery aligns with organizational goals and community needs. Represent the department on various internal and external committees, fostering strong partnerships. Utilize technology and data to improve service efficiency and customer experience. Anticipate municipal trends and proactively support Council priorities.

Minimum Qualifications


Proven leadership experience in a municipal or public-sector setting, preferably in planning, policy, or business services. Strong knowledge of municipal governance, budgeting, strategic planning, and policy development. Demonstrated ability to lead teams, manage complex projects, and communicate effectively with diverse stakeholders. Strong political acumen and the ability to navigate multi-stakeholder environments with diplomacy and integrity.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Public Administration, Finance, or a related field. A minimum of 7 years of progressive related management and senior level experience.

Preferred Qualifications


A professional designation such as a CPA, MPA, or MBA would be considered an asset to the role. Experience in municipal operations or a regional government setting would be a considerable asset.
